Tennie Toussaint Photographs

Tennie Toussaint was a columnist for the Burlington (VT) Free Press during the 1960s and 1970s who also collected photographs as a hobby. This digital collection brings together her photographs of agricultural landscapes, community events, and the logging of Danville, Vermont during the early 1900s. All told, there are over 65 photos here that document barn raisings, family gatherings, and other sciences from the past. Users can search the photographs by topic or genre and it's a fascinating look into this corner of Vermont history.
